Chrome 将跟 SPDY 说再见,拥抱 HTTP/2 - 开源中国社区
Chrome 将跟 SPDY 说再见,拥抱 HTTP/2
oschina 2015年02月10日

Chrome 将跟 SPDY 说再见,拥抱 HTTP/2

oschina oschina 发布于2015年02月10日 收藏 27 评论 38

有免费的MySQL,为什么还要买? >>>  

互联网竞争环境相当的复杂,这个也体现在 Web 浏览器对不同技术和标准的支持,这些技术和标准都直接导致了性能和兼容性的表现差异很大。可能很多人天真的认为应该有一些真正开放的标准,但是静下来想想,是谁在制定标准呢?如果互联网真的开放,那为什么看起来是几个巨头公司在掌舵呢?所以。。。没有真正开放的标准。

而 Google 就是这样一个在做决策的公司,决策着 Web 的未来,当然这不一定是坏事。它会从自身利益角度来决定一些技术的走向,例如今天 Google 宣布其 Chrome 浏览器将跟 SPDY 说再见,开始实现 HTTP/2 协议。

来自 Google 的 Chris Bentzel 说:HTTP 是 Web 万维网的基础网络信息,目前广泛使用的是 HTTP/1.1 标准,该标准是 1999 年在 RFC2616 中定义的。但是到了今天 Web 的发展日新月异,同时一个新版本 HTTP/2 也在标准路上不断前行。我们计划在未来数周内发布的 Chrome 40 中支持 HTTP/2 标准。

Bentzel 进一步解释:一些关键的特性如连接复用、Header 压缩、优先级和协议握手改进等等已经完成。Chrome 从 6 开始就支持 SPDY,但其大多数优点都已经在 HTTP/2 中出现,因此是到了跟 SPDY 说再见的时候了。我们计划在 2016 年移除对 SPDY 的支持,同时也将移除名为 NPN 的 TLS 扩展。服务器开发人员强烈鼓励迁移到 HTTP/2 和 ALPN。

从这点来看,将 SPDY 换成 HTTP/2 是正确的选择,虽然二者都是”开放“的,但是 HTTP/2 更能代表未来,而且用户也不会感觉到太大的变化。

via betanews

本站文章除注明转载外,均为本站原创或编译。欢迎任何形式的转载,但请务必注明出处,尊重他人劳动共创开源社区。
转载请注明:文章转载自 开源中国社区 [http://www.oschina.net]
本文标题:Chrome 将跟 SPDY 说再见,拥抱 HTTP/2
分享
评论(38)
最新评论
0

引用来自“nullptr”的评论

刚看到标题的时候还有位http2.0能破墙呢,失望
确实能用来。。。网上有教程
0

引用来自“eechen”的评论

Google是人类的希望,Google万岁,没有Google,全世界都要退回石器时代!
Oracle不把Java奉献给我大Google,那Oracle就永远是乌龟王八蛋!
股沟好痒的!

引用来自“双城记”的评论

这人真是脑子有问题的。好坏不分的
他一分钟不吃药就会这样
0
今早才看了点SPDY的资料,好险
0
?+1024
0

引用来自“eechen”的评论

Google是人类的希望,Google万岁,没有Google,全世界都要退回石器时代!
Oracle不把Java奉献给我大Google,那Oracle就永远是乌龟王八蛋!
股沟好痒的!
是不是又忘记吃药了?
0
HTTP/2 非常好啊
0

引用来自“阿信sxq”的评论

走标准化的路,这个和微软完全是两个套路的啊,赞一下

引用来自“struct”的评论

微软的 IE11 已经支持 HTTP/2 了。
凡事要实事求是,讲理由、讲证据,拿事实说话。
不要见到谷歌就夸,见到微软就喷。
http://www.oschina.net/news/56024/microsoft-explain-http-2

引用来自“阿信sxq”的评论

首先我不是见到谷歌就夸,见到微软就喷。我只是想到了就说一下,现在chrome占有率也是很高的,能够放弃已经很好的SPDY而支持标准,但微软曾经为了占有市场和标准不兼容。现在的IE就是web开发人员的痛,难道你不赞同?
赞同。
虽然我不是做Web开发的,但前年公司给分配了一个任务,做一个Web展示,要兼容各种浏览器,花了两个星期时间做完,兼容Chrome、Firefox、Opera、IE6+,结果没想到用户还有用 IE5 的。
我至今记忆犹新。
0
始乱终弃拔屌无情……
0
学习了。
0

引用来自“阿信sxq”的评论

走标准化的路,这个和微软完全是两个套路的啊,赞一下

引用来自“struct”的评论

微软的 IE11 已经支持 HTTP/2 了。
凡事要实事求是,讲理由、讲证据,拿事实说话。
不要见到谷歌就夸,见到微软就喷。
http://www.oschina.net/news/56024/microsoft-explain-http-2
首先我不是见到谷歌就夸,见到微软就喷。我只是想到了就说一下,现在chrome占有率也是很高的,能够放弃已经很好的SPDY而支持标准,但微软曾经为了占有市场和标准不兼容。现在的IE就是web开发人员的痛,难道你不赞同?
0

引用来自“阿信sxq”的评论

走标准化的路,这个和微软完全是两个套路的啊,赞一下
微软的 IE11 已经支持 HTTP/2 了。
凡事要实事求是,讲理由、讲证据,拿事实说话。
不要见到谷歌就夸,见到微软就喷。
http://www.oschina.net/news/56024/microsoft-explain-http-2
0
spdy都还不知道呢,貌似换成http2.0好理解多了
0

引用来自“喵小强”的评论

反正客户就指定要IE了!!
要打败客户
0
spdy改名http2更加名正言顺的发展而已,喷子们太得意了。
0

引用来自“阳光灿烂的日子”的评论

又来!google抛弃的东西太多了,不过这一次我要点个赞
不是抛弃,就是改了个名字,加了点东西。

维基百科的一段话:
HTTP/2的目标包括异步连接复用,头压缩和请求反馈管线化并保留与HTTP 1.1的完全语义兼容。 httpbis工作小组最初考虑了Google的SPDY协议、微软的SM协议3和Network-Friendly HTTP更新4。Facebook对各方案进行了评价并最终推荐了SPDY协议5。HTTP 2.0的首个草稿于2012年11月发布,其内容基本和SPDY协议相同6
0

引用来自“LeeRoBeRt”的评论

呵呵 google就是好就是好 下一个放弃的就是golang和dart了 再下一个就是angular
1.Go完全是开源化运作,没有绑定android等等自家的平台,就像python,你咋不说当初python之父在google的时候google放弃python,python就挂了?
2.dart是死是活说不准,但es6,es7里一些东西和dart里面几乎一样,如果说dart最终失败,那么es7吸收了里面好的东西。,让js最终不再那么烂,有何不好?
3. angular?随你怎么说,一点不影响这个如今的第一框架。
0

引用来自“阿信sxq”的评论

走标准化的路,这个和微软完全是两个套路的啊,赞一下
++赞
0

引用来自“eechen”的评论

Google是人类的希望,Google万岁,没有Google,全世界都要退回石器时代!
Oracle不把Java奉献给我大Google,那Oracle就永远是乌龟王八蛋!
股沟好痒的!
这人真是脑子有问题的。好坏不分的
0
Google是人类的希望,Google万岁,没有Google,全世界都要退回石器时代!
Oracle不把Java奉献给我大Google,那Oracle就永远是乌龟王八蛋!
股沟好痒的!
0
G家确实为http2推广做了不少事
顶部